
A Paris Saint-Germain star once appeared to have his payslip, tax bill and even his home address leaked over the internet.
Keylor Navas, currently of Newell’s Old Boys, was once considered among the best shot-stoppers in Europe.
The Costa Rican joined Real Madrid in 2014 and went on to win 12 trophies, including one La Liga crown and three consecutive Champions League titles with the Spanish giants.

He subsequently signed for French giants PSG in 2019, where he went on to win three Ligue 1 titles, three French cups and reach another Champions League final, which the Parisians lost to Bayern Munich.
And months into his time in Paris, Navas appeared to have his PSG payslip leaked across X.
The alleged payslip claimed Navas had earned 614.000 euros (£525,000) in September 2019, meaning he would be earning more than seven million euros a year.

The reported pay slip also featured Navas’ tax deductions, which amounted to a little over 98,000 euros (£83,000) for that month.
When asked about the veracity of the tax bill in a press conference at the time, Navas laughed and said: "Don't be surprised if in the future you see me buying a villa in Miami, a building in China or a house in Paris.
"I imagine there are many who are bored and do this kind of thing. It's sad, but that's how it is.

“It doesn't bother me. So much the better if it makes some people laugh. What interests me is football.
“Unfortunately, things like that happen. But I insist, don't be surprised if one day you see that I have a private jet in my name."
Navas spent time at Nottingham Forest on loan, after he fell down the PSG pecking order when the French club signed Italian keeper Gianluigi Donnarumma.
